Chelsea’s attacking midfielder Willian has rejected Manchester United’s offer and pledged his commitment to Stamford Bridge.

According to a report by The Sun, Chelsea’s Brazilian midfielder Willian has rejected a bid to move to Manchester United, and chosen to continue playing for Premier League champions Chelsea instead.

Manchester United were reported to be very keen on signing Willian, especially since his former boss Jose Mourinho is a huge admirer of the player. It did seem like the deal might go through considering how the Brazilian struggled for game time under Antonio Conte.

In fact, it was Jose Mourinho who brought the Brazil international to Stamford Bridge way back in 2013 and he was one of the very few positives from Mourinho’s disastrous final few months in charge at Chelsea last season.

Willian even scored seven goals by the time it was Mourinho’s turn to bid adieu to Stamford Bridge, and he was reckoned as one of the strongest Chelsea players.

While he did struggle to get enough chances this season, he also been impressive during the few chances he did get. For example, he came off the bench to aid Chelsea in sealing the Premier League title at West Brom last Friday even as they have two more games to spare.

Despite that, his overall influence on Chelsea has diminished and he could start only in 13 league games this season when compared to the 32 appearances of the previous season. Regardless, Willian still wants to stay loyal to Stamford Bridge.

When Chelsea picked up the title in 2015, Willian played a key role and was very influential even during the period when Mourinho got sacked.

However, ever since Conte took over and switched to the 3-4-3 formation, Pedro and Eden Hazard’s form has skyrocketed, leaving little scope for Willian.

Although he has not played much this season, it should still come as good news to Chelsea, while Jose Mourinho might have to re-think his midfield options as the transfer window looms closer.

Meanwhile, Willian’s Chelsea team-mate Thibaut Courtois has also stressed upon his desire to remain with Chelsea even as there are strong rumours of him being prime target for Spanish giants Real Madrid.
